要求
如果您有 CUDA 显卡,请遵循NVlabs/stylegan3的要求。
通常的安装步骤涉及以下命令,它们应该设置正确的 CUDA 版本和所有 python 包
conda env create -f environment.yml
conda activate stylegan3
然后安装附加要求
pip install -r requirements
否则(对于带有 Silicon Mac M1/M2 的 MacOS 上的 GPU 加速,或仅 CPU)请尝试以下操作:
cat environment.yml | \
grep -v -E 'nvidia|cuda' > environment-no-nvidia.yml && \
conda env create -f environment-no-nvidia.yml
conda activate stylegan3
# On MacOS
export PYTORCH_ENABLE_MPS_FALLBACK=1
在 Docker 中运行 Gradio 可视化工具
提供的 docker 镜像基于 NGC PyTorch 存储库。要在 Docker 中快速试用可视化工具,请运行以下命令:
docker build . -t draggan:latest
docker run -p 7860: 7860 -v "$PWD":/workspace/src -it draggan:latest bash
cd src && python visualizer_drag_gradio.py --listen
现在您可以从 Gradio 打开共享链接(在终端控制台中打印)。
请注意,Docker 镜像大约需要 25GB 的磁盘空间!
声明:任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。